If we told you there was a way you could get a custom HD projector for under €499 ($704) with DVI and HDMI inputs, you might go so far as to give your left arm for such a device.  Unfortunately that would be the wrong idea, as you’d probably need that arm to put the projector together: you see, it’s a DIY kit, and according to German tinkerer Maxi Huber it’s the best piece of home entertainment kit he’s bought in some time.

The kit is supplied by German firm G&P Optoelectronics, and there’s a variety of different options depending on what sort of resolution you’re after and what inputs you need.  Maxi’s system has not only DVI and HDMI inputs but S-video and VGA, and the lamp used costs €20 ($28) so even if you leave it on 24/7 and burn it out in short order, you won’t bankrupt yourself.

Maxi’s video below shows the different stages involved, and while the DIY guide is in German it’s also full of pictures so even those who can’t understand the words should get somewhere.  Anyone thinking of building their own HD projector?
